知识问答
怎么迁移mongodb
迁移MongoDB数据库可以按照以下步骤进行:
1、准备工作
确保目标数据库服务器已安装MongoDB并运行正常。
确定源数据库和目标数据库的连接信息,包括IP地址、端口号、用户名和密码等。
备份源数据库,以防止数据丢失。
2、停止源数据库服务
在源数据库服务器上执行以下命令来停止MongoDB服务:
“`
systemctl stop mongod
“`
3、迁移数据
使用mongodump
命令将源数据库的数据导出为BSON格式的二进制文件,在源数据库服务器上执行以下命令:
“`
mongodump host <source_host> port <source_port> username <username> password <password> db <database_name> out <backup_directory>
“`
<source_host>
是源数据库服务器的IP地址,<source_port>
是源数据库的端口号,<username>
和<password>
是连接源数据库的用户名和密码,<database_name>
是要迁移的数据库名称,<backup_directory>
是导出备份文件的目录路径。
4、将备份文件传输到目标数据库服务器
使用SCP或其他文件传输工具将导出的备份文件传输到目标数据库服务器的指定目录。
5、恢复数据到目标数据库
在目标数据库服务器上执行以下命令来启动MongoDB服务:
“`
systemctl start mongod
“`
使用mongorestore
命令将备份文件导入到目标数据库中,在目标数据库服务器上执行以下命令:
“`
mongorestore host <target_host> port <target_port> username <username> password <password> db <database_name> <backup_directory>/<backup_file>
“`
<target_host>
是目标数据库服务器的IP地址,<target_port>
是目标数据库的端口号,<username>
和<password>
是连接目标数据库的用户名和密码,<database_name>
是要导入的目标数据库名称,<backup_directory>
是备份文件所在的目录路径,<backup_file>
是要导入的备份文件名。
6、验证迁移结果
连接到目标数据库并执行一些查询操作,确保数据已经成功迁移并且可用。
7、更新应用程序配置(可选)
如果应用程序使用了连接字符串或配置文件来访问源数据库,需要将其更新为目标数据库的相关配置信息,这可能涉及到修改连接字符串、主机名、端口号、用户名和密码等信息。
怎么迁移微信聊天记录上一篇:淘宝店铺代销怎么发货
最新文章
- 如何在MySQL中创建新的数据库目录?
- seednet,Seednet软件下载教学
- 如何将本地MySQL数据库顺利迁移到RDS for MySQL?
- Nagios支持哪些插件和扩展来增强监控功能
- 怎么测电脑电源功率够不够用
- 如何有效扩展MySQL数据库容量?
- 硬盘分区魔术师使用方法 硬盘分区魔术师下载
- 微信怎么不带图片发朋友圈-微信不带图片发朋友圈教程
- 如何通过练习题有效提升MySQL数据库技能?
- xp恢复出厂设置教程,XP的系统还原_xp怎么恢复出厂设置?
- 如何寻找长尾关键词
- 如何在MySQL中创建数据库的精确副本?
- 什么是jsp虚拟空间,了解jsp虚拟空间的重要性
- 虚拟机是双路好还是单路好
- 如何创建MySQL数据库的外部链接?
- 网站空间租赁一年需要多少钱
- 在MySQL中合并字段内容相同的数据库时,字符集和字符序如何影响数据一致性?
- Windows系统通过计划任务设置定时重启
- 凡科建站登陆
- MySQL数据库引擎对比,BOM表现如何?